What are the key UX considerations for businesses looking to capitalize on blockchain technology?

Blockchain technology presents a unique set of opportunities and challenges for organizations aiming to enhance their digital offerings. As this technology moves from the realm of the speculative to practical applications, understanding and implementing effective User Experience (UX) principles becomes paramount. This focus ensures that blockchain-based products and services are accessible, user-friendly, and capable of driving adoption among target audiences.

Understanding User Needs and Blockchain Complexity

One of the primary UX considerations for organizations leveraging blockchain technology is the need to demystify blockchain for end-users. Blockchain's inherent complexity and its departure from traditional centralized systems can be daunting for users unfamiliar with the technology. Therefore, simplifying the user interface and providing clear, jargon-free explanations of how and why blockchain is being used are critical steps. This approach helps in reducing barriers to entry and enhancing user trust and engagement. For example, organizations like Coinbase have successfully navigated this challenge by offering a simplified user interface that abstracts the complexity of blockchain transactions for users, making the process of buying, selling, and storing cryptocurrencies more accessible to the general public.

Additionally, user education is an essential component of UX design in blockchain applications. Given the novelty of blockchain and the misconceptions surrounding it, incorporating educational tools, tutorials, and support within the application can significantly improve user comprehension and confidence. This not only aids in onboarding but also empowers users to make informed decisions, a critical factor in financial and data-sensitive applications. Organizations should aim to create a seamless educational journey within their platforms, guiding users through the intricacies of blockchain technology and its benefits.

Finally, feedback mechanisms are crucial for understanding user needs and refining the UX. Active engagement with the user community through surveys, user testing, and forums can provide valuable insights into user challenges, preferences, and desired features. This ongoing dialogue enables organizations to iterate on their UX design, ensuring that the product evolves in alignment with user expectations and technological advancements.

Security and Transparency

Security is a paramount concern in blockchain applications, given the sensitive nature of transactions and data involved. However, enhancing security measures should not come at the expense of user experience. Organizations must strike a balance between implementing robust security protocols and maintaining a frictionless user experience. For instance, while multi-factor authentication (MFA) and biometric verification add layers of security, they should be integrated in a way that minimizes user inconvenience. Simplifying security processes through intuitive design can significantly enhance user compliance and overall satisfaction.

Transparency is another critical UX consideration in blockchain applications. Users often value blockchain for its potential to offer greater transparency compared to traditional systems. However, presenting blockchain data in a user-friendly manner can be challenging due to its complexity. Organizations should focus on designing interfaces that effectively communicate the state and outcomes of transactions, smart contracts, and other blockchain operations in an understandable format. Real-time notifications, clear status updates, and accessible transaction histories are examples of how transparency can be woven into the UX to foster trust and user engagement.

Moreover, the use of visualizations to represent blockchain operations can greatly enhance user comprehension and transparency. Complex processes, such as the path of a transaction through the blockchain or the execution of a smart contract, can be made more accessible through graphical representations. This not only aids in demystifying blockchain but also helps users to visualize and understand the benefits and processes underlying their transactions.

Accessibility and Inclusivity

Ensuring that blockchain applications are accessible to a wide range of users is a critical UX consideration. Accessibility involves designing products that can be used by people with a variety of disabilities, including visual, auditory, physical, speech, cognitive, and neurological disabilities. This is not only a matter of ethical responsibility but also expands the user base, making blockchain technology more inclusive. Techniques such as screen reader compatibility, voice navigation, and alternative text for images and animations can make blockchain applications more accessible to users with disabilities.

Inclusivity extends beyond accessibility to consider cultural and linguistic diversity among users. Blockchain technology has the potential to reach a global audience, making it essential for organizations to design UX that is culturally sensitive and available in multiple languages. This involves not only translating text but also considering cultural norms and preferences in design, color schemes, and imagery. For example, a blockchain-based payment platform might adjust its interface and content to reflect the local currency, payment habits, and languages of the regions it serves, thereby enhancing user engagement and adoption.

Ultimately, the key UX considerations for organizations looking to capitalize on blockchain technology revolve around simplifying the complex, ensuring security and transparency, and promoting accessibility and inclusivity. By focusing on these areas, organizations can create blockchain applications that not only meet the technical requirements of the technology but also deliver a compelling, user-friendly experience that drives adoption and satisfaction.
